View PostAbyss, on 27 May 2019 - 05:38 PM, said:

I only watched it scattershot, but i recall thinking the time jump and Cesar thing was a bad idea and being pleasantly surprised.


The time jump was due to Lawless's pregnancy. They worked her pregnancy into the show during S5 (Eve) but after the birth (off screen, of her son Julius...yes she and Tapert named their kid Julius), they needed the show to allow for Eve to not be in the picture as a baby, so the show jumps 25 years to age her up.

As I recall the benefit of the time jump is that the world has largely moved on from Greek Gods, and Christianity has become big...so you can have this storyline of these two amazing warrior women from a different time, trying to sort out their place in a world that has forgotten them.
